The Plea for Emotional Rescue in 'Stop Stop' by The Black Keys

The Black Keys' song 'Stop Stop' delves into the tumultuous emotions of a relationship that is both intoxicating and destructive. The lyrics paint a vivid picture of a love that is hard to resist despite its evident toxicity. The protagonist is drawn to someone with an 'evil streak,' a metaphor for the harmful and manipulative behavior of their partner. Despite warnings from others, the protagonist admits to being 'much too weak' to stay away, highlighting the powerful grip of this unhealthy relationship.

The repeated plea to 'stop' throughout the song underscores the protagonist's desperation and helplessness. The lines 'can't you hear me call' and 'can't you see me fall' emphasize the emotional turmoil and the sense of being ignored or unseen by the partner. This repetition serves as a cry for help, a desire for the partner to recognize the damage being done and to cease their harmful actions.

The metaphor of being 'cooled by the rain in the eye of the storm' captures the fleeting moments of relief and affection that make the relationship even more confusing and painful. These moments of warmth are juxtaposed against the overall chaos and destruction, making it harder for the protagonist to break free. The song encapsulates the struggle of loving someone who is bad for you, the internal conflict of wanting to stay despite knowing you should leave, and the hope that the partner will change their ways.
